About the role

  • Junior Instructional Designer driving digital upskilling initiatives at E.ON Digital Technology. Focused on enhancing employee skills in Data, AI, and Automation.

Responsibilities

  • Support the end-to-end design, development and deployment of upskilling content on digital topics such as Data & AI, Automation, and Personal Productivity
  • Apply iterative instructional design approaches (primarily SAM) to ensure content is effective and engaging
  • Assist in analyzing learner personas, their needs, and pain points, and translate these into clear learning objectives
  • Use (AI-based) content authoring tools for content creation; upload, configure, and manage courses within the Learning Experience System (LXP)
  • Collaborate closely with subject matter experts (SMEs) and business stakeholders to ensure content accuracy and alignment with business goals
  • Help ensure all learning content is accessible, user-friendly, and meets internal quality standards
  • Contribute to analyzing learning content performance data to continuously improve instructional materials

Requirements

  • Degree or near completion in Instructional Design, Human Resource Management, Education, Organizational Psychology, or a related field
  • Up to 2 years of professional experience with a proven track record of success in upskilling and reskilling, preferably in an international matrix environment
  • Business fluent in German and English (both written and verbal)
  • Basic proficiency in our core authoring stack, especially Articulate 360 (Rise and Storyline), TechSmith Camtasia and Synthesia; initial experience with Adobe Creative Suite (primarily Photoshop, Illustrator, Premiere Pro) or Frontify is a strong plus
  • Foundational understanding of, and initial practical experience with, the SAM instructional design approach. Understanding of other approaches, such as ADDIE, is a plus
  • Passion for learning, people, technology and the energy transition. Affinity with digital topics (e.g., Data, AI, Automation, etc.) is a plus
  • Mindset to complete tasks conscientiously, reliably, and end-to-end, with a high level of personal commitment
